Attic Fan Repair in Provo, UT
Attic fan repair services focus on restoring and maintaining attic ventilation systems that help regulate indoor temperatures and reduce energy costs. These services typically cover repairs for various types of attic fans, including ceiling-mounted and roof-mounted units, addressing issues such as faulty motors, broken blades, wiring problems, or malfunctioning controls. Homeowners often seek these services to improve airflow, prevent moisture buildup, and ensure the attic fan operates efficiently during warmer months or when ventilation problems arise.
Before requesting attic fan repair, property owners usually want to understand the specific symptoms their system exhibits, such as unusual noises, inconsistent operation, or complete failure to turn on. It’s also helpful to know the age and type of the existing fan, as well as any recent changes or issues in the attic environment. Having this information can assist in diagnosing the problem accurately and determining whether repairs will restore proper function or if a replacement may be necessary.

Attic Fan Repair Questions
What causes an attic fan to stop working? Common causes include electrical issues, a faulty switch, or worn-out motor components that prevent proper operation.
How can I tell if my attic fan needs repair? Signs include unusual noises, insufficient airflow, or persistent overheating of the attic space.
Is it necessary to repair or replace an attic fan? Repair is often possible for minor issues, but replacement may be needed if the fan is outdated or extensively damaged.
What are typical problems addressed during attic fan repairs? Repairs often focus on fixing wiring issues, replacing motors, or restoring proper blade function to ensure efficient airflow.
